Subject: cxgb4: add support to delete hash filter
Patch-mainline: v4.15-rc1
Git-commit: 3b0b3bee56dd4e5cd1976a046f391a1435d727b2
References: bsc#1064802 bsc#1066129

Use a combined ulptx work-request to send hash filter deletion
request to hw. Hash filter deletion reply is processed on
getting cpl_abort_rpl_rss.

Release any L2T/SMT/CLIP entries on filter deletion.
Also, free up the corresponding filter entry.
